North Dakota won 78-67.

Sophie Reichelt led the Western scoring with 17 points, while Taylor McClintock added 11 points and Taylor Higginbotham scored 10.

North Dakota would grow their lead to as many as 20 with just under two minutes to play before Western closed the game on a 9-0 run.

Western was out-rebounded 48-26.

Attendance at North Dakota was 1,385.
